**Onboarding: Sort Stability in Reportsmith**

Reportsmith's builder guarantees stable sorting: rows with equal keys keep their source order. The stability check runs in CI against the fixtures service, which serves canonical ordered datasets. When adding new sort columns, regenerate fixtures and rerun the check locally. Calls to the fixtures service authenticate with the key below.

API key for yahig-tadup: kto7_ubizbYm

Ticket TL-442: The staging instance of Chronoplan, our school timetable solver, was deployed with the production solver queue credentials. This means staging runs can enqueue jobs against live district schedules at Hollowbrook Academy. We need to rotate the affected credential and point staging at its own queue. For the security review, note that the fix requires updating the staging .env with the following line:

vault entry, tagug-hahip: ARCHIVE_KEY3=e34

## Formula sandbox tuning

User-supplied formulas in Gridmoor execute inside a restricted interpreter with hard ceilings on time, memory, and call depth. Reviewers should confirm any change to these ceilings is justified in the PR description, since raising them widens the abuse surface. Defaults were chosen from production traces. The current limits are as follows.

limits module of tafog-fawip:
WEIGHTS = {
    "julix": 57,
    "lamys": 992,
    "kasvan": 209,
    "quenok": 750,
    "alddor": 259,
    "oliath": 1009,
    "wenix": 815,
}

## Onboarding: Keywheel (secrets rotation)

Keywheel rotates service credentials across the Dovetail platform every 14 days. As release manager, you approve rotation batches before each deploy train. Check the pending queue, verify no freeze window is active, then approve. Failed rotations roll back automatically; escalate repeats to platform ops. First-time access to the approval console requires unsealing your operator profile with the recovery passphrase below.

recovery phrase for fajep-yaweg: gilath-sorox-wenius-rusdor-keliel-zorius